It's Convenient

You can exercise at home without having drive to a gym, or deal with bad weather. This is particularly beneficial for families with young children or an active schedule that stops you from hitting the gym during the time of the day.

If you are primarily interested in losing weight or becoming fit, a treadmill could be a great choice. Walking is a low-impact exercise that most people can tolerate regardless of their fitness levels. As you build strength and endurance you can begin walking. Many treadmills have an ergonomic cushioning system which reduces the impact on your joints.

There are many workout programs available on most treadmills. Some have virtual locations around the globe that take you to mountains, beaches and other stunning scenery so you don't get bored with your workout routine. You can also adjust the surface of your treadmill to make it harder or smoother, based on how your knees and ankles feel after exercising.

You can select one that has a 22-inch touchscreen with high-definition display. This display will show all the information you need about your workout, including distance, time, and calories burned. More affordable treadmills may have smaller screens or require you to push buttons to display the information, while higher-end models tend to display all of the important information on a single screen.

Make sure to determine the space before you purchase a treadmill. Also look for treadmills that can be folded when not in use. Some treadmills are able to be stored under furniture so that you don't have to worry about taking up valuable floor space.

It's Affordable

You can save money by owning a treadmill at home. It will allow you to avoid costs for gym memberships, transportation and other costs associated with exercising. It will also give you the flexibility of exercising whenever you want, without worrying about crowded gyms or inclement weather. Many people feel more comfortable exercising in their own homes.

Choose the amount you wish to spend and what features you are most interested in before you begin looking for a treadmill. In general, higher-priced treadmills offer more advanced features than lower-priced models. You should also consider how often you will use the treadmill, and if any other family members will also be using it, since this could affect the durability.

It's Private

If you are worried about exercising in public, running on a treadmill at home could be a great choice. You can exercise at your own pace, not worrying about other people watching you. It's also safer than running outdoors particularly if your home is located in a dangerous area or you are concerned about being hounded. You can run on your treadmill anytime, without worrying about the weather or waiting in the gym's queues.

Treadmills are programmable, which means that you can tailor them to your personal fitness level. You can alter the speed or incline to suit your preferences, regardless of whether you're a novice or an experienced runner who wants an intense workout. This also helps to prevent boredom as your body will not get used to the same routine. Some treadmills are equipped with specialized race simulation software that can help you prepare for your next race.

Treadmills aren't just great for personalizing your workout, but they can also be used to increase muscle mass. You can build leg muscles by increasing the resistance of your workout with the function of incline. This type of exercise could be beneficial for those who want to lose weight, since it can increase your metabolism and make your body burn fat more quickly.

Treadmills can also be used to boost bone density. Numerous studies have demonstrated that jogging, running or walking on a treadmill improves bone density. These kinds of exercises can make your bones stronger, which could lower the risk of developing osteoporosis in later life.

It's Comfortable

Exercise is a big part of maintaining an active lifestyle. However, many factors can interfere with our fitness goals, including expensive gym memberships, weather conditions and lengthy commute times to the gym. If these obstacles are preventing you from getting the exercise you require, treadmills at home can provide convenience and comfort that removes these obstacles.

You can exercise at your own pace, without worrying about bad weather or traffic. It is a safe and private environment for those who are self-conscious when exercising in public or in the gym.

Before you purchase a treadmill, take note of the features that are most important to you. Do you see relaxing walks, intense running or something in between? The answer to this question can aid you in narrowing your treadmill options based on speed, incline setting and much more. If you are planning to run on a treadmill, choose one with a larger track and an engine that is stronger to handle the demands of your intense exercise.

When you are buying a treadmill you should also consider your budget and the space you have. Do you have plenty of floor space for a large treadmill, or do you want to keep the machine folded away when not in use? Some treadmills fold in half by pressing a button. This can save space when you're not making use of them. Certain treadmills have wheels that allow you to move them around your home. Be sure to do some research regarding warranties prior to you make your purchase. A treadmill's warranty is a good indication of its durability and quality and is why it's worth it to pay more to purchase a treadmill with an outstanding warranty.
